How do you remove a drawer from a cabinet?
Grab the drawer on both sides near the back of the drawer, if you have a single stationary slide on the drawer sides. Lift the back of the drawer and pull it toward you to remove the drawer from the cabinet. Step 4. Search for a lever or push tab on the movable slide, if you have slides that move with the drawer.

Is it possible to repair a drawer track and slide?
The ball bearings are typically inside both of the corresponding slides. Note that wheels and bearings can’t be repaired, and replacement parts for them are typically not available. Before you attempt to replace the slides, remove one of the drawers and decide which type and size you need.
What should I do if my cabinet drawer is not sliding?
Screw the slide marked CR to the right side. Slide the drawer in and out of the cabinet. If it doesn’t slide smoothly, loosen the screws in the oval-shaped holes, tap the drawer in the direction needed, test again and repeat if needed. Tighten the screws when the drawer glides smoothly.
How does a drawer release from a side mount slide?
Most under-mount slides pull out and release the drawer from the cabinet; you may have to jiggle the drawer to get it to release. Most side-mount slides employ a lever or tab to release the drawer, located halfway along the slide when the drawer is in the open position.
What do you need to know about drawer slides?
Drawer slides are the thin metal rails installed on both sides of a drawer and on the interior of the cabinet, dresser or other piece of furniture into which the drawer slides.
